Best definition
Baby dragon poop.
Typically from a combination of “Wooba”meaning baby dragon and “Goosha” meaning poop. Often used as a food source

for its rich proteins. Consuming it is also an effective way of disposal aswell since raising dragons, especially little ones can get messy.

Do you eat woobagoosha?

Woobagoosha is full of protein.

I ate woobagoosha today.

This wooba just took a goosha.